Output efc6f36d225cc70c5b2e16941fec63ec8a8a44a3e1ee577c293964ebcf0da0ea:1

value
8794109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dd7a654864ced45ac1bae48246ddcf7a42742bf OP_EQUAL
address
34QoriHKf6YouRrhM4xPfqcywVyRTEv2Wx
transaction
efc6f36d225cc70c5b2e16941fec63ec8a8a44a3e1ee577c293964ebcf0da0ea
spent
true